Man City made the perfect start to the new season and Jamie Carragher thinks the influence of new assistant manager Pep Lijnders is already showing.
City thrashed Wolves 4-0 at Molineux in what was the most convincing performance of any side over the opening weekend.
Erling Haaland bagged a brace while new signings Tijjani Reijnders and Rayan Cherki both got themselves on the scoresheet with fine finishes.
City, who are known for dominating the ball and breaking opponents down, looked particularly dangerous on the counter on the night.
